Default battery dead, tried to jump...wouldn't work

hi! i hope someone can help us. Battery was dead; no lights, no electrical lights at all. used portable battery jumper to no avail; lights come on, though faded a bit, but no starting of engine. any advice? may try to jump with another car and jumper cables tomorrow. even if it starts, does this mean that the battery needs to be recharged? thanks so much for your help

If you can get it started, get over to autozone or similar. They have testers they can connect up and run a test to see if its the battery or the alternator. If its the alternator it could also have taken out your battery due to improper charging..

Did this happen suddenly?

if it did, it doesn't seem to just be a battery problem. Typically. When a battery starts to fail, it will fail to start a few times but still able to be jump started.

Regardless, the battery should be changed. You can remove the battery from the car and bring it to a place that tests batteries for free (autozone, Walmart, orileys, etc).

make sure to correctly diagnose the problem before fixing as these type of work/parts are expensive

If a cell went bad chances are a boost isn't going to help. You will need a new battery. Costco carries either Kirkland Brand or Interstate. If you wanted to give it one last effort you might connect a charger to it for 20 minutes or have some let you hook up to their running car for 10 minutes to see if it will take enough of a charge to get you going.
